Clinical Director - Shropshire

• Superb opportunity for a Clinical Director role to work across 3 RCVS accredited practices on the Shropshire/North Wales border • Top-tier facilities including an ophthalmoscope, auroscope, in-house laboratory, X-ray, ultrasound, and more • Flexible rota pattern and working hours • Excellent salary up to £80,000 • Relocation allowance up to £5,000

We are excited to present an outstanding opportunity for a Veterinary Surgeon to join a passionate team as a Clinical Lead/Clinical Director in Shropshire. This full-time position involves working across three RCVS accredited practices that cover Shropshire and the North Wales Border, where you will lead and support the clinical team. Your role will encompass managing a diverse range of surgical and consultation cases, organising vet rotas, overseeing clinical budgets, and guiding the team, all while having the freedom to develop your own clinical interests.

Located on the beautiful North Wales/Shropshire Border, these practices offer a truly unique lifestyle opportunity. Enjoy the peace and tranquillity of countryside living while being just a stone's throw from amenities and major cities. With excellent transport links to Manchester, Chester, and Shrewsbury, you can effortlessly balance the best of village life with the excitement of city adventures.

This role is ideal for someone ready to take the next step in their career, with access to leadership training and support. Our client values your vision and will work with you to craft a role that plays to your strengths and passions, ensuring that your ideas and ambitions shape the future of the practice.

The practices are RCVS accredited, boasting top-tier facilities including an ophthalmoscope, auroscope, in-house laboratory, X-ray, ultrasound, and more. Our client is committed to continuous investment in their team, facilities, and processes, always prioritising employee wellbeing, exceptional patient care, and an outstanding client experience.

Our client is looking for a candidate with excellent interpersonal skills and a commitment to kindness and respect. Your dream job isn't just a possibility; it's a promise they intend to keep. Join a team where your passion and leadership can truly make a difference.

The Rota: • Full time role - flexible rota pattern and working hours

The Benefits: • Excellent salary up to £80,000 DOE • Relocation Allowance up to £5000 • 7.6 weeks annual leave, inclusive of bank holidays • Your birthday as a paid day off • Enhanced family-friendly policies, including maternity/paternity/adoption/shared parental and surrogacy pay • Private Medical Insurance • Cycle to work scheme • £1250 CPD allowance with 40 hours paid CPD leave pro rata • Certificate support • BVA membership • VDS cover • RCVS fees • Pension scheme • Discounted staff pet care
